> unknown protocol: l a URI of the form http://www.w3.org has "protocol" http, and in general the protocol part of a URI is the bit before the : Most likely you have use a uri of the form l:\a\b\c which is something in the uregistered URI protocol "l" which saxon does not know. Some programs will silently correct your error and replace this by a uri in the file protocol fil:///l:/a/b/c but the programs are wrong to do this: generating an error is the right thing to do.
